Liability

When you've been injured in an accident on the road it is crucial to find an attorney with the necessary experience to negotiate successfully with insurance companies. A compassionate and experienced attorney can make the process easier.

A good New York City truck crash lawyer will thoroughly examine your case to determine the cause of the accident and who is responsible. They'll also identify and gather relevant proof to prove your claim.

There are a number of parties that can be held responsible for a truck crash, including the trucking company, the driver and the truck manufacturer. In addition, a shipping company may be held liable for improper loading of their cargo or a municipality may be held liable for not adequately maintaining streets.

The liability of the trucking company can be increased if the driver was drunk or intoxicated, driving or engaging in other reckless conduct that caused the collision. The company's supervisors are also accountable for ensuring that drivers have a clean driving record and are competent to operate the vehicle in a safe manner.

The trucking company may also be held accountable for negligent maintenance. If the truck was not properly maintained, they may be liable for any damages associated with the repair or replacement of damaged parts.

Another possible source of potential liability is a business that created a defective item in the truck. The manufacturer could be held accountable for any damages resulting from the failure of a crucial part in the truck.

One of the first steps that a truck accident lawyer will take to determine who is responsible is evaluating the truck at the scene of the crash. This includes taking a look at the damage to the vehicle and checking for mechanical defects or issues.

If the truck is equipped with an "blackbox," it may provide crucial information regarding the condition of the vehicle at the time of the crash. The information can be used by your lawyer to determine who was responsible for the accident and how much compensation you'll receive.

Expert Witnesses

Expert witnesses are crucial to the outcome of a truck accident case. They can assist in establishing fault, identify damages, provide expert knowledge, and improve your credibility.

Accident reconstruction specialists are the first kind of expert witness attorneys representing victims of truck accidents may call on. They are experts to analyze the physical evidence found at the scene of the accident, and using their findings to reconstruct the accident and identify who was at fault.

They usually look for skid marks, road debris and other evidence to determine how the accident happened. They may also examine the "black box" data of the driver's vehicle to see whether they were speeding, or distracted at the time of the collision.

They can also look over maintenance records and black-box data from the trucking company to determine if they adhered to safety standards that could have prevented this crash. They can also look over the truck to determine the presence of any issues which could have caused a breakdown, such as an inefficient tire.

Another kind of expert witness truck accident lawyers might choose to use is medical expert. They are experts in treating injured patients and are well-versed in the effects of a collision. They can provide evidence of how the injuries sustained during the accident have affected your quality of life and how long they'll remain in your body in the coming years.

An economic expert can assist you in proving your damages. They can calculate the amount of medical bills, lost income and other financial losses. This is essential in proving that the injuries you sustained are significant and disproportionate to the incident itself.

Time Limits

There are numerous laws that govern trucking operations, including rules regarding a driver's maximum driving hours, mandatory medical exams and drug testing. These regulations can be difficult to navigate and if you've been involved in a trucking crash be sure to contact an experienced lawyer to ensure your rights and rights and interests.

The time is of the essence when you're planning to file claims for damages after a trucking accident in New York. The state has strict laws and statutes of limitation that limit the time you must file a lawsuit.

The most important thing to remember is to act fast and get an attorney's advice as early as you can. In the event of a delay, your case to become weaker which could lead to a lower settlement. In addition, evidence may be lost due to time or witnesses' memories of the accident.

The statute of limitations in New York on personal injury claims is three years. This is a time-bound deadline so you will want to present your attorney with all the details about your case prior to the time running out.

Other laws and regulations may affect your ability to claim damages after a trucking accident lawyers near me accident in the state of New York. For example in the event that the truck that caused your accident was owned or operated by a public agency (like the NY Sanitation Department for accidents involving garbage trucks) you must give the agency with notice prior to making a claim.
